Who needs a DOT Physical?

In West Carson, TN, to maintain your commercial operations, a valid DOT medical certificate is mandatory if you:

  • Hold a CDL - class A, B, or C for interstate trade
  • Operate vehicles exceeding 10,001 lbs. GVWR in interstate trade
  • Carry over 8 passengers (commercial) or beyond 15 (non-commercial)
  • Haul hazardous materials needing placards as per DOT rules
  • Are employed by DOT-regulated bodies like FMCSA or similar entities requiring DOT medical qualifications

What Will Fail a DOT Physical?

Medical Conditions That Can Fail a DOT Physical

  • Vision & Hearing: Vision below 20/40 in each eye (even with correction), inability to discern signal colors, or hearing inability to detect a whisper from 5 feet away.
  • Blood Pressure & Heart Disease: Unmanaged hypertension (≥180/110 mmHg), recent heart events, stroke, uncontrolled angina, or non-cleared defibrillator implants.
  • Diabetes: Poorly controlled diabetes with frequent hypoglycemia or complications that hinder safe operation.
  • Sleep Apnea & Respiratory Issues: Untreated obstructive sleep apnea causing fatigue, or severe pulmonary disease impairing oxygen levels.
  • Neurological Disorders: Epilepsy or other seizure conditions (unless exempted), disorders causing sudden consciousness loss, vertigo, or tremors.
  • Substance Abuse: Current use of illicit drugs, alcohol dependency, or misuse of prescriptions affecting driving capabilities.
  • Psychiatric & Cognitive Disorders: Severe unmanaged psychiatric conditions or cognitive deficits that affect decision-making and reflexes.

Temporary vs. Permanent Disqualification: Some conditions might temporarily disqualify you until medical documentation is provided (e.g., hypertension control, diabetes management). Others, such as untreated seizures or defibrillators, are often deemed permanently disqualifying by FMCSA.

A DOT physical typically includes a review of the driver’s health history and medications, vision screening, hearing assessment, vital signs (blood pressure, pulse), urinalysis (checking specific gravity, protein, glucose), and a full physical examination by a certified medical examiner. Upon passing, a Medical Examiner’s Certificate (DOT medical card) may be issued for up to 24 months.
You must have a valid DOT medical certificate if you: hold a commercial driver’s license (CDL) Class A, B or C for interstate commerce; operate a vehicle over 10,001 lbs GVWR in interstate commerce; transport more than eight passengers (for hire) or over fifteen passengers (not for hire); or transport hazardous materials requiring placarding under DOT regulations.
